Fig. 6.
Synaptic function of NMJ4 does not correlate with morphology. Intracellular recordings of miniature evoked excitatory junction potential (mEJP) amplitude and frequency and evoked excitatory junction potentials (EJPs) are from muscle 4 in 0.4 mM external calcium. (A) Representative mEJP recordings, quantified in C and D. Scale: 2 mv; 200 ms. (B) Representative EJPs evoked by electrical stimulation of the appropriate segmental nerve bundle. Scale: 5 mv; 200 ms. (E) Average EJP amplitude, a measure of the number of vesicles released in response to an evoked action potential, is quantified for each species. Error bars indicate SEM (minimum n = 12). mel, melanogaster; pun, punjabiensis; fun, funebris; vir, virilis.
